Job Description
The Garden Center Customer Service Rep is a full time seasonal hourly position structured to all aspects of garden center operations in conformance with established Farm policies, strategies, and procedures.
Primary Responsibilities: Performs any functions necessary, within scope of authority and expertise, to provide the highest level of customer service and responsiveness to the needs of individuals, families, businesses, and organizations served by the Farm. 1) Receives exposure to all aspects of garden center operations through hands-on experience and training with responsibility for customer service and plant maintenance for a large variety of annuals, perennials, foliage, herb, and vegetable plants. 2) Must possess strong communication skills in order to respond to customer questions concerning plant care and culture, and diagnosing plant problems. Advises customers on all aspects of garden design, including but not limited to; garden design and construction, window box and container design and care, vegetable garden planting and care, fertilization, tree and shrub care and design, insect and disease identification and water requirements for all plant material. Provides information and makes suggestions on greenhouse and garden center products to ensure customer satisfaction. Reports any customer complaints to the Garden Center Management team for a timely resolution. 3) Assists in all areas of plant maintenance such as watering, potting, container filling, and weeding. Responsible for crop protection techniques and the ability to recognize, diagnose, and properly treat plants. Distributes biological insects. Receives pesticide training and may mix and apply chemicals and fertilizers, as needed, under the Garden Center Manager's supervision. Maintains greenhouse environmental controls through venting, temperature control, heating, irrigation and shading. 4) Assists in garden center merchandising with plant and hard good displays, inventorying, stocking, signage, pricing, and receiving of live and hard good materials. Keeps Garden Center Manager apprised of customer product requests and make recommendations. 5) Works with other garden center staff to maintain the cleanliness of the garden center display and surrounding areas. This includes recycling, sweeping, trash removal, and any other activity necessary to maintain a tidy, clean environment. 6) Conducts landscape sales: tallies purchases and enters sales into the retail point of sales system. 7) May assist garden center staff on purchasing trips for resale products. Other Responsibilities: 8) During seasonal peaks, work requirements may necessitate long hours including early starts and late finishes 9) Position requires attending all Farm and departmental training The above is a description of the ordinary duties of the position. It should be expected that from time to time, other duties both related and unrelated to the above may be assigned, and therefore, required.
Position Requirements: Previous horticultural or agricultural experience is preferred. Must be self-motivated, well organized and possess strong communication skills. Must be physically fit, able to lift 50lb, and stand for extended periods. This position involves both inside and outside work in both hot and cold weather. Work requirements necessitate overtime hours and weekend work; normal work-week is 5 days and overtime pay of time and a half is paid for hours worked over 40 and on Sunday. Position requires carrying a two-way radio at all time while on duty.
